Julia Roberts’ Kids Eat Kale

Pin It

Kind of shocking, I’ll admit. Most kids love French fries, Julia Roberts’ kids love kale. Hey, whatever floats your boat!

She talks about the organic garden the family grows in New Mexico. What a FUN idea.

"The children love it and I think it’s the best training for them. I
think when children know their food sources they’re more inclined to
eat what they’re growing because they’re so proud of it. To watch my
kids eat kale is a pretty proud moment for me as a mom."

Julia also adds that though it might seem she’s taken a break from working, the actress in her is still there.

"Of course life has changed and I work less, but I was never one to
work too much. I never did years of movie-after-movie-after-movie but
when you’ve got three toddlers in the house you’re performing all day
long, anyway, with puppet shows and stories – I act around the clock."

And she says that much has changed since she started out.

"It has to be very confusing and difficult to be a young woman in Hollywood today," she says.

"The
focus is so surgical on these girls, on everything they wear and every
detail of their lives and in quite a negative way. I really don’t know
how they handle it."
